15 Freezer Meals For Busy Households

Earlier I talked about how to organize a freezer meal swap group, and a few factors you need to take into account.  Today we are going to discuss some meals that work well for freezer swap meals.  These meals have all been tried and passed the test. 

Collage of freezer meals.

 

Just because a meal tastes amazing the first time, doesn’t mean that it actually freezes and re-heats well.  Perhaps your noodles get mushy because the meal has to much liquid once it thaws, or maybe your chicken is dry because you don’t have enough sauce to compensate for the re-heating process. 

I have a few recipes that don’t reheat well because of the extra liquid from the frost of being frozen ruins them.  This is not something you want to have happen when sending on to other households. 

15 Freezer Meals For Busy Households

White Chicken Spaghetti Bake

  • White Chicken Spaghetti Bake – Make 2 and enjoy one for dinner tonight and one for later.  Thaw overnight in the fridge and bake for dinner.  
  • Stromboli – Freeze before baking.  Thaw the night before and bake according to directions.  
  • BBQ Meatloaf
  • Brown Sugar Glazed Pork Tenderloin – Combine all ingredients in a freezer bag and freeze.  Pull out of the freezer the night and place in the fridge the night before.  This will allow your meat to marinate and bake as directed.
  • Homemade Meatballs
  • Swiss Steak – Stop at direction number 4 and freeze. Pull out of the freezer the night before and place in the fridge to thaw.  Adjust cooking time as needed but I generally need 2 2.5 hours to cook thoroughly depending on how thawed this is from the night before (which means I didn’t pull it out till the morning of).
  • Beef Stroganoff – Can be heated up in the microwave or reheated in the oven.
  • Spicy Sausage Balls 
  • Game Day Chili -Have recipients warm this meal on the stovetop with a little extra water or in the crockpot.   I love using this meal to swap with because I can make a huge pot at once in my canner and have enough for the whole swap.  Recipients can use this over hotdogs, potatoes or it makes an amazing delicious meal on a cold winter day.  Send along a bag of shredded cheese and crackers and the fixings are complete as well.
  • Pico De Gallo Chicken Soup
  • Pumpkin Waffles with Oats
  • French Onion Soup
  • Copycat Cheddar Bay Biscuits – freeze unbaked and add a couple of extra minutes to your baking time.
  • Homemade Pound Cake – always a good idea to keep one of these on in hand in the freezer.  They thaw quickly when you’re in a rush for dessert.  
  • Cream Of Mushroom Soup
